The highest common factor (HCF) of 140 and x is 20
Zielflug [23.3K]

Answer:

x=60

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that ,

HCF of 140 and x=20,

LCM of 140 and x =420.

Solution:

It is known that the product of two numbers is equal to the product of their HCF and LCM, i-e:

140*x= HCF*LCM

Putting in the values provided,

140*x=20*420

140*x=8400

x=8400/140

x=60

Hence the variable x is 60.
